Wins are fun! That’s it, that’s the preview. OK, maybe I will write a little more. Rhody is coming off their best game since a home win against a 20-3 Davidson team in February of last year. The Rams look to build on the great performance Wednesday night as they take on the La Salle Explorers Saturday afternoon. Rhody is looking for revenge after losing to La Salle earlier this season in Philly. Prior to that game, URI had an eight-game winning streak against the Explorers. After beating URI, La Salle beat their next opponent (UMass on the road) but have lost 4 in a row since.

Leading the Explorer is sophomore guard Khalil Brantley, who is leading the team in both points & assists, 14.1 & 3.9 respectively. He is the Explorers only double-digit scorer, but senior Josh Nickelberry is right on the cusp with 9.9 points per game. He has shot poorly over his last 6 games, at just 26.5%. As of late, Explorers coach Fran Dunphy has not been pleased with Brantley, Nickelberry, guards Jhamir Brickus & Anwar Gill. All 4 of them sat to start the game even with them being 4 of their top 5 scorers. Per Dunphy he said, “Their sense of timing was different than mine. We’ll just leave it at that.” Will be interesting to see how many minutes they play in this game against Rhody. Downlow, they have the Drame twins, Fousseyni & Hassan. In the last matchup against Rhody they had a combined 6 blocks to go along with 15 points & 14 rebounds.

If Rhody can play like they did on Wednesday night, they should be able to pick up the home win. Wednesday night Brayon Freeman is what all Rhody fans were waiting for when he announced he was transferring to the Ocean State. He did a great job filling up the stat sheet & went a blistering 5 for 11 from deep while the rest of team shot a paltry 1 for 11. Rhody was able to get the win even with Dayton shooting 50% from the floor because they had less turnovers, out rebounded & out hustled the Flyers. Play smart, limit turnovers and I see Rhody grabbing their 4th conference win of the season. They will need this win to try to stay out of the bottom 4 of the conference to avoid the play in games come conference play. Currently only La Salle & Loyola are below Rhody in the standings. Rhody, UMass, Davidson & Saint Joseph’s are all tied at 3-5

There should be a decent crowd at Saturday’s game. The students are back on campus & with a 2:00 pm start, their hangovers should just start to be subsiding so they can head to the game to start it all over again. This game is also part of the five-game mini plan, so that could also help to number of people in the stands. Rhody should be favored by about 6 points in this one. Although Rhody is just 8-12 ATS, I think they win & but not so sure about the cover. My prediction is URI 70 – La Salle 65. Go Rhody!!

Against URI when LaSalle won in OT the Explorers started:
Brantley 6’1” SOPH - 43 minutes
Gill 6’4” JR - 37 minutes
Drame, Fousseyni 6’7” SR - 31 minutes
Nickelberry 6’4” SR - 20 minutes
Doucoure 6’9” SR - 7 minutes

Last game vs Davidson starters
Sanchez-Ramos Freshman 6’2” - 25 minutes
Marrero R/Freshman 6’5” 30 minutes
Drame, Fousseyni 6’7” SR - 30 minutes
Drame, Hassan 6’7” SR - 27 minutes
Doucoure 6’9” SR - 17 minutes

Fran Dunphy removed Brantley, Gill and Nickelberry from starting and gave them just 15, 7 and 3 minutes respectively.

Only Fousseyni Drame and Doucoure started vs Davidson and URI.

Dunphy inserting Hassan Drame gets him more height (the Drame brothers came over from St Peter’s after last season).

Dunphy has started 10 different players this season already.

Dunphy’s new starting Freshmen guards are Andres Marrero who is from Caracas Venezuela and Jorge Sanchez-Ramos is from Spain.
